Description
A delightful dessert combining rich chocolate and fresh strawberries, layered with creamy mousse on a graham cracker crust.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 1/2 cups crushed graham crackers
- 5 tablespoons melted butter
- 2 (8 oz) packages cream cheese, softened
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- 1 cup mascarpone cheese
- 1 cup whipped cream
- 1/4 cup sugar
- Strawberry sauce (for drizzle)
- Fresh strawberries (for garnish)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). In a bowl, mix crushed graham crackers with melted butter and press into the bottom of a springform pan.
- In another bowl, beat cream cheese and 3/4 cup sugar until smooth. Add eggs one at a time, mixing well, then add sour cream. Pour over the crust and bake for about 40 minutes or until set. Allow to cool.
- For the no-bake layer, mix mascarpone cheese, whipped cream, and 1/4 cup sugar until smooth. Spread over the cooled baked layer.
- Chill in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ours or overnight.
- Before serving, drizzle with strawberry sauce and garnish with fresh strawberries.
Notes
Ensure the cream cheese is softened for a smoother texture. Chill the cake adequately to let it set properly.
